Geocache Description:


I've always enjoyed the view along here. This scenery was the best part of my drive during the 16 years of daily trips between Moncton and Sackville a few years ago. It's a great view of the valley on a clear day and can be quite spectacular at sunset.
To the left you can see the mouth of the Chignecto Basin towards the Bay of Fundy as well as the majestic Shepody Mountain near Hopewell Cape.
If you're coming from Moncton, take exit 488 (east Memramcook) on to the East Memramcook Road. Go back the same way for the (Moncton) on-ramp. If you're coming from Sackville take exit 488 (Pont Rouge Road) and turn right onto East Memramcook Road. Retrace your steps to go back to Sackville. Don't do this cache from the highway.
Park at the top of the dirt road and enjoy the 300 meter (4 minute) walk down to the cache. Driving down this ATV trail/access road may be hazardous to your vehicle's health.
As you approach the cache, take a little caution with small children and dogs as the 4 lane highway is near, just ahead and below you. You will need to keep an eye on little wanderers.
The cache is an ammo can with logbook and goodies. Not really winter friendly.
